GENERAL RESPONSIBILITES

The Stockbridge-Munsee Community is seeking a tribal staff attorney. This attorney will provide a wide range of legal services for the Community with an emphasis on contract review and drafting for tribal government departments and tribal business entities and legal research. This attorney will also work with Employment Law issues, and collections/garnishments with occasional court appearances as required.

STANDARD DUTIES:

  1. Advise and represent the Tribal Government, Tribal Administration, Tribal Programs and Tribal Businesses in dealings with federal, state and local governments and agencies.
  2. Provide contract review and drafting, work on special projects, and conduct legal research.
  3. Advising the HR Department on various employment law issues.
  4. Prepare collections and garnishments for court.
  5. Occasional court appearances as required.

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S REQUIRED:

  1. Must be a graduate of an A.B.A approved Law School.
  2. Must be licensed to practice law in Wisconsin or licensed in another state and eligible for Wisconsin admission within nine (9) months.
  3. Must have at least 4 years of licensed practice as an attorney.
  4. Work experience as an attorney in an Indian law or government setting strongly preferred.
  5. Strong organizational, writing, and communication skills.
  6. Ability to work constructively with others, good judgment, and ability to learn quickly.
  7. Ability to work independently and under pressure required.

The Stockbridge-Munsee Community operates as an equal opportunity employer except Indian Preference is given in accordance with the Employee Preference Policy Ordinance as permitted under federal law. Due to broad federal funding and the co-mingling of fiscal resources, all tribal government operations jobs are treated as federally-funded for the purposes of the Employee Preference Policy Ordinance unless specifically identified as not federally-funded.
